Basic Function & Responsibility
Support the daily operations of the school cafeteria by preparing, serving, and storing food in accordance with USDA, Texas Department of Agriculture (TDA), and Bastrop ISD guidelines. Ensure a clean, safe, and welcoming food service environment that promotes student wellness and academic readiness.

Food Preparation and Service
Prepare and serve meals according to the daily menu and standardized recipes.Ensure proper portion control and presentation standards are met.Support safe handling, storage, and rotation of food using FIFO (First In, First Out) practices.Assist with catering and special event meal preparation as needed.Recordkeeping and Compliance
Maintain accurate daily production records and temperature logs.Complete HACCP logs and ensure food safety procedures are followed at all times.Follow Bastrop ISD and TDA regulations for sanitation, safety, and program compliance.Assist with completing food requisitions and recording supply usage.Sanitation and Safety
Clean and sanitize food preparation areas, serving lines, dining areas, and kitchen equipment.Follow all health, safety, and sanitation protocols as established by local, state, and federal regulations.Report safety hazards or equipment malfunctions to the Kitchen Lead immediately.Maintain personal hygiene, proper uniform, and professional appearance.Inventory and Support Tasks
Assist with receiving, organizing, and storing food and non-food supplies.Help conduct inventory counts and support inventory control practices.Carry out additional tasks as assigned by the Kitchen Manager or Child Nutrition administration.Participate in staff development and complete annual continuing education requirements.Supervision Exercised

Mental Demands / Physical Demands / Environmental Factors
Tools / Equipment UsedCommercial kitchen equipment including ovens, mixers, warmers, steamers, slicers, fryers, dishwashers, and utility carts
PostureProlonged standing and walking
MotionFrequent bending, stooping, reaching, pushing, and pulling
LiftingAbility to lift 15-44 lbs. on a regular basis
EnvironmentExposure to cleaning chemicals, equipment noise, and potential kitchen hazards; ability to work in hot, cold, and humid environments
Mental DemandsMaintain emotional control under stress; work with frequent interruptions; reliable attendance and punctuality required; commitment to customer service and teamwork in a fast-paced environment
